Transaction 9060ef176dc5788411a3712bf1e48ef29f2ad8af8312f394df7a1300dc0ab3c3

1 Input
2 Outputs
  • 9060ef176dc5788411a3712bf1e48ef29f2ad8af8312f394df7a1300dc0ab3c3:0
  • value  128143
    address  39hdFYzaetw12XsV7SpBvzJLeXrtK2aa51
  • 9060ef176dc5788411a3712bf1e48ef29f2ad8af8312f394df7a1300dc0ab3c3:1
  • value  642620629
    address  3DqPyakT6kjceXeBEFGwaXWKtAGun4QQpV